VA01/Va02 - Add column before Material column

Former Member
0 Kudos

Hi all,

I am having some issues in moving my columns in VA01 (and so on).

My first column is Item followed by Material and then PO Number but I want to move PO Nr. before Material column and it is just not possible with drag-&-drop funcitonality: if I want the PO Nr. column anywhere else in the layout then no problem.

It seems as if there is a lock on that Material column.

Any ideas?

Its because number of key field defined in that table control is 2. It won't let you move first two column.

However you can change that.

Click on the layout button (right top corner of table control), click on Administrator button then change number of fixed column to 1 and activate it.

thank you for the message, what if I do not have an Administrator button in my Layout?

Is it possible to define via SPRO?

And one more question is this issue user-related? As in do we have to do the change pr. user or can one do it for general use?

I don't think this setting will be available in SPRO as this is table control specific. I could be wrong.

User profile need following authorisation to get that Administrator button on layout screen of table control

Authority Object : S_ADMI_FCD

Id S_ADMI_FCD field TCTR (Table control settings throughout the system).

With the description of TCTR value, I am guessing here that setting will be throughout system but not sure.
